WebCamp Lineman - Offensive Lineman and Defensive Lineman Camps, News, Training and Evals. WebThe yellow line in football is the digital representation of the spot of the first down marker . It is used on television broadcasts to make watching a game easier for fans at home. The line is a near exact measurement of the 10 yards needed to gain for a new first down. A kickoff in football is when the place kicker, a kicker on the special teams, kicks the ball to the opposing team. Kickoffs are performed behind restraining lines and must go 10 or more yards to count or be touched by the receiving team. On a kickoff, the ball is placed on a tee.
